Have auto-lock at 10mph, but pressing the unlock button inside or on the fob unlocks all the doors.marriedblonde said:Yep there is, mine has autolock set. Push the button to unlock and only the drviers door unlocks, press twice and tehy all do. Drive off and all doors lock when I hit 10mph.
Remove the ignition key and only the drivers door unlocks. You can program it so all doors unlock.
